Static scheduling of multi-rate and cyclo-static DSP-applications

摘要

The high sample-rates involved in many DSP-applications, require the use of static schedulers wherever possible. The construction of static schedules however is classically limited to applications that fit in the synchronous data flow model. In this paper we present cyclo-static data flow as a model to describe applications with a cyclically changing behaviour and build a static schedule for them as well. We also propose a new scheduling method for both multi-rate and cyclo-static applications. Characteristic for this method is that the graph does not need to be transformed into a single-rate equivalent. The new scheduling technique has been implemented in GRAPE-II (Graphical RApid Prototyping Environment).
